Subject: Broker upgrade next week

Hi, welcome to the rotation. We're upgrading the Fernwick message broker from 4.2 to 5.0 on Tuesday. Expect brief consumer reconnect churn on the Lanternfish queues; this is normal and alerts are suppressed for the window. If lag persists past 15 minutes, page the platform team rather than restarting consumers yourself. The full runbook, rollback steps, and queue ownership table are on the internal page below.

dashboard of tawef-hagug = https://superset.norvadyn.local/display/projects/build/ticket/build/spaces/ticket/1e989f0e6c200d20fc4ae06b

**Key Ceremony Checklist — Item 7: Partner SFTP Drop (Support Team)**

After both keyholders from Fernwick Systems have signed the ceremony log, verify the Harborlane SFTP drop accepts the newly minted host key. Upload the test manifest, confirm receipt in the Ospry console, and record the timestamp carefully. Before sealing the envelope, confirm the drop's recovery passphrase below matches the ledger entry.

recovery phrase for fahap-haduf: casvan-eliius-novmir-holiel-oliwyn-brivan-gilax-gilael-gilax-wenius-rusael-istius-ralys-julwyn

Ticket #4471 — Vault locked, blocking template perf fix

Severity: high. The Rendercrest template engine is spiking p99 on the Millbay tenant; fix is ready but the deploy credentials sit in the ops vault, which auto-locked after three failed attempts yesterday. Support: do not retry credentials manually. Apply the perf patch only after vault reopen. Per policy, reopening requires the recovery passphrase, recorded below for this incident.

vault phrase of tawig-taduf = zorath-oliwyn